Zhuojun Ma is a scholar working on Biomaterials, Biomedical Engineering and Paleontology. According to data from OpenAlex, Zhuojun Ma has authored 15 papers receiving a total of 478 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Biomaterials, 5 papers in Biomedical Engineering and 4 papers in Paleontology. Recurrent topics in Zhuojun Ma's work include Calcium Carbonate Crystallization and Inhibition (9 papers), Bone Tissue Engineering Materials (5 papers) and Paleontology and Stratigraphy of Fossils (4 papers). Zhuojun Ma is often cited by papers focused on Calcium Carbonate Crystallization and Inhibition (9 papers), Bone Tissue Engineering Materials (5 papers) and Paleontology and Stratigraphy of Fossils (4 papers). Zhuojun Ma collaborates with scholars based in China and United Kingdom. Zhuojun Ma's co-authors include Liping Xie, Rongqing Zhang, Shuo Li, Rongqing Zhang, Cen Zhang, Jing Huang, Zhenguang Yan, Changzhong Li, Guannan Wang and Juan Sun and has published in prestigious journals such as Journal of Biological Chemistry, PLoS ONE and Frontiers in Microbiology.
